The pub was designed by the outstanding pub architect Nowell Parr and built in the 1920s. Between 2007-2010 Gordon Ramsay ran the pub as The Devonshire. The pub was then vacant for a year. In June 2011 a new gastro pub opened as the Devonshire Arms, but ceased trading 8 months later. The pub was then marketed for a further 3 months, before it was reopened as a community pub hub. This failed after two months. Planning permission was granted in 2013 to demolish the pub and build seven flats.
